Emma was born and raised in New Zealand, so her ethnic background alone will intrigue viewers. She is also one of the rare few Hydrocephalus survivors! She lived to tell the world about her trauma through song. She has had 10 BRAIN surgeries, and a total of 24 surgeries altogether. Additionally, Emma went through severe depression, suicide attempts, drug addiction and sexual assault. She tours the world as a musician/singer/songwriter expressing herself through music. Emma is a Youth Empowerment Coach and motivational speaker.
